Aircraft Update:
EI-DMZ Boeing 737-8FH c/n 29671 Jeju Air Ferried Shannon-Dublin 04/04/18 after paint prior delivery to become HL8302.
G-ZBAU Airbus A320-214 c/n 3293 Iberia Airlines Ferried Shannon-Birmingham 04/04/18 after paint prior delivery to become EC-MUK.
SE-RFV Boeing 737-86N c/n 32669 TUI Airlines Belgium Ferried Shannon-Brussels 02/04/18 to become OO-SRO.
